Limitations and Careful Usage
No single asset is suitable for every project. There are specific scenarios where Floral Ocean Creatures Hand Drawn should be used with caution. For formal corporate branding, this playful style may undermine authority. Similarly, in dense information layouts, the intricate details can compete with data charts or bullet points, causing cognitive overload for the reader.
Be mindful of scale. When scaling down these illustrations for small mobile graphics or favicons, the fine lines may disappear or become muddy. Always preview your designs on actual mobile screens to ensure readability. Also, avoid placing these assets on low-contrast backgrounds. The delicate lines need space to breathe; otherwise, the design will look messy and unprofessional. If your brand is strictly minimalistic, these ornate creatures might feel too busy.
Practical Designer Notes for Implementation
To get the most out of this SVG design or PNG design bundle, follow these practical steps before integrating them into your campaigns:
- Test Color Palettes: Ensure the illustrations complement your existing brand colors. You may need to adjust the hue or saturation slightly to match your palette perfectly.
- Check Black and White: Print the asset in grayscale to verify that the shapes hold up without color assistance. Good modern design relies on strong form, not just color.
- Font Pairing: Experiment with typography. These illustrations pair well with serif fonts for an elegant look, sans-serif fonts for modern clarity, and script fonts for a personal touch. Avoid overly heavy display fonts that clash with the delicate line work.
- Review Spacing: Give the illustrations room to breathe. Use ample white space around the edges to maintain a clean, professional branding appearance.
- Confirm Licensing: Before using these in paid campaigns or client work, double-check the commercial license. Ensure you have the right to use the commercial design for resale or advertising purposes.
